Experience Coastal Living at Its Finest in the 'Jewel' Streets of Saltburn
Nestled within the enchanting 'Jewel' streets of Saltburn by the Sea, this area boasts an array of eclectic period properties, predominantly hailing from the Victorian era. Here, you'll find an irresistible blend of stately elegance and contemporary comfort, making it a haven for executive couples seeking apartments and families in search of spacious homes.

A Slice of Coastal Paradise:
Life in the 'Jewel' streets revolves around the serene rhythm of the nearby sea. The sound of waves breaking on the shore provides a soothing backdrop to daily life, creating an idyllic setting for your new home.

Abundant Amenities:
This charming neighbourhood is a treasure trove of amenities, offering something for everyone. From quaint local shops to vibrant attractions, you'll find a rich tapestry of leisure options right at your doorstep. Whether it's a leisurely stroll on the promenade, exploring boutique shops, or savouring local culinary delights, this area offers endless possibilities.

Educational Excellence:
Families will be delighted to know that Saltburn Primary School and Huntcliff School both hold Ofsted's prestigious 'Good' rating, ensuring that your children receive a top-tier education without any worries.

Community Heartbeat:
Milton Street, nestled at the top end of the 'Jewel' streets, is a thriving community hub. It's home to a collection of trendy bars, restaurants, and favoured eateries, creating a lively centre for residents to connect and unwind.

Historical Wonder:
At the opposite (lower) end of the street, you'll discover one of Saltburn's greatest treasures - the oldest working water-balanced cliff tramway in Britain. It offers a unique and picturesque journey from the town to the iconic Pier below, where you can embrace the history and beauty of this coastal gem.

Effortless Commuting:
Whether your daily journey leads you south to the scenic shores of Whitby or north to the vibrant hub of Middlesbrough and beyond, you'll find the A174 easily accessible by car. Additionally, Saltburn Railway Station provides excellent rail links, ensuring convenient and stress-free commuting.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on December 21, 2021

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on January 6,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
